For the marinas around Lake Wallenpaupack, preparing for boating season starts months ahead of time like here at First Class Marina in Tafton.
After the boats are summarized, piles of blue shrink wrap that protects the boats from the winter elements are left behind. Volunteers with different agencies across Wayne County have started a new effort to recycle it. One by one, bundles are tossed into the compactor truck to keep it out of landfills. Each wrap can weigh anywhere from 8 to 10 lb. Volunteers say to date they've been able to collect nearly 9,000 lb of plastic. A company called Ultra-Poly then turns the plastic into items like garbage cans, plastic benches, and other items.
